Cambridge is particularly renowned for its stunning ranch-style homes, which embody a unique architectural charm that appeals to many. Characterized by their single-story layouts, open floor plans, and seamless integration with the surrounding landscape, ranch-style homes provide both comfort and convenience. These homes often feature spacious living areas, large windows that invite natural light, and easy access to outdoor spaces—perfect for family gatherings or quiet evenings spent enjoying the serene Wisconsin sunsets.
